Resilience Through Art: The Story of a Palestinian Painter in Gaza
Adnan Abu Yusuf a Palestinian artist residing in the Gaza Strip returned home after a ceasefire to find his dwelling reduced to a gray ruin by the ravages of war. Amidst the debris he discovered the ashes of 42 paintings and approximately 85 awards and honors that represented years of cultural and artistic endeavors. Despite the profound losses including the tragic death of his son Ahed during the conflict Abu Yusuf took up his brush once more. His mission is to portray the suffering of the people of Gaza and the stark reality of life under siege through the lens of art breathing life back into the charred walls of his home.

Cyber Attack on Israel’s Largest Health Organization by Hacker Group
A significant cyber assault has targeted the largest healthcare organization in Israel known as Clalit Health Services. The hacker group identifying itself as 'Hanzala' announced their infiltration into Clalit’s extensive network which encompasses hundreds of clinics and several hospitals. Claiming to be soldiers of the resistance front the group has dubbed their operation 'Justice for the Oppressed'. They assert that their actions have rendered Clalit’s network inoperative posing a serious challenge to the security of Israel’s healthcare infrastructure. In a statement the hackers disclosed sensitive medical information pertaining to over 10000 patients as evidence of their breach. They argue that the purported security of the Israeli regime has collapsed under their will. The group described their operation as a legitimate response to decades of occupation and crimes against the people labeling it as a 'small warning'. They emphasized that should the regime's transgressions continue more severe responses will follow. This incident represents a notable blow to the symbolic infrastructure of healthcare in Israel and raises significant concerns regarding cybersecurity.

Islamic Jihad Condemns U.S. Consular Services in Settlements as Support for Annexation
The Islamic Jihad movement has issued a formal statement condemning the U.S. Embassy's recent decision to provide consular services in the Israeli settlement of Efrat located in occupied territories near Bethlehem and Hebron. This action is characterized by the movement as a blatant endorsement of the ongoing settlement expansion and the Israeli government's annexation policies. In its statement Islamic Jihad asserted that the U.S. Embassy's decision represents a significant violation of international agreements and norms. The movement emphasized that the claim by Washington that these services are part of a 'mobile program for American citizens abroad' does not mitigate the gravity of this action. The organization underscored that such claims are merely attempts to normalize the presence in occupied West Bank territories transforming it into a routine affair that serves the objectives of land annexation. They stressed that offering official services in settlements established on occupied land is not just an administrative measure but a clear political and legal acknowledgment of the legitimacy of these settlements effectively participating in the silent annexation of the West Bank by the Israeli government. Islamic Jihad highlighted that providing services to settlers on land that is forcibly seized daily signifies an enhancement of the occupiers' control over the West Bank and the forced displacement of its original inhabitants. The statement further noted that Washington which has previously supported occupation through financial aid and weaponry is now extending diplomatic cover to these actions. The movement labeled the U.S. government as a 'direct partner' in the annexation projects of the West Bank asserting that the public statements from the U.S. President opposing annexation are nothing more than a media deception aimed at advancing Jewish settlement and annexation projects without provoking sensitivity among Arab governments. Additionally Islamic Jihad pointed out that this action aligns perfectly with the recent comments made by Mike Huckabee the newly proposed U.S. ambassador to Tel Aviv. In conclusion Islamic Jihad emphasized that this move reflects a complete coordination between Washington and Tel Aviv to disregard the historical rights of the Palestinian people and to solidify the occupation across all territories.

Dismantling of Terror Network Responsible for Attacks on Security Forces in Fajr County
A significant operation led to the dismantling of a terrorist network linked to extremist groups and foreign intelligence services. This network based in the southeastern borders of the country was responsible for the martyrdom of security personnel at checkpoints in Fajr County Kerman Province. In a coordinated effort the intelligence agents of the Imam Zaman (May Peace Be Upon Him) organization in collaboration with the Quds Ground Forces of the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ps and provincial law enforcement successfully apprehended eight members of this terrorist group. During the operation three terrorists were killed in clashes with the security forces highlighting the ongoing efforts to combat terrorism in the region.
